| Product Overview |
The All-Steel Laboratory Workbench is a heavy-duty laboratory furniture solution designed for boar semen laboratories, pig artificial insemination centers, veterinary laboratories, livestock breeding stations, research facilities, and other professional laboratory environments.
The workbench is manufactured from thickened galvanized steel sheet with an epoxy resin coated surface, providing good resistance to corrosion, acids, alkalis, abrasion, heat, moisture, and frequent cleaning. Its strong structural design provides a stable platform for microscopes, semen analyzers, precision balances, thermostatic equipment, laboratory instruments, containers, and routine semen processing operations.
The laboratory table can be customized according to room dimensions, laboratory workflow, equipment layout, storage requirements, and utility requirements. Optional configurations can include cabinets, drawers, reagent shelves, sinks, laboratory faucets, electrical sockets, and other accessories for complete semen laboratory planning. |

| Installation & Maintenance |
Installation:
- Confirm laboratory dimensions, equipment positions, utility connections, doors, aisles, and operating workflow before production.
- Place the workbench on a firm, level, and clean floor.
- Level and secure the bench according to the supplied installation plan.
- Connect optional sinks, faucets, electrical sockets, and other utilities according to local installation requirements.
- Install reagent shelves, cabinets, drawers, and accessories in the designated positions.
- Check all fasteners, doors, drawers, utility connections, and work surfaces before operation.
Routine Maintenance:
- Clean the work surface regularly with laboratory-compatible cleaning agents.
- Remove chemical spills, semen residue, water, and cleaning solution promptly.
- Avoid prolonged exposure to highly corrosive substances beyond the material's recommended resistance.
- Inspect cabinet hinges, drawer slides, handles, fasteners, and supports periodically.
- Keep sink drains and laboratory faucets clean when these accessories are installed.
- Do not exceed the designed load capacity of the workbench, shelves, or drawers.
- Repair damaged coating promptly to maintain corrosion protection.
- Keep electrical accessories dry and inspect connections according to laboratory safety procedures.
